About This Provider

Dr. Rebecca Schaffer is a board-certified Diplomate of the American Board of Orofacial Pain (ABOP), a credential held by a select group of dentists nationwide. She earned her D.D.S. from Columbia University College of Dental Medicine and then pursued specialized post-doctoral training through a General Practice Residency at Hackensack University Medical Center and an Infectious Disease Fellowship at Rutgers College of Dental Medicine. This hospital-based and fellowship-level education gives Dr. Schaffer a medical-dental foundation that extends well beyond standard dental school training. She practices at Southwest Orofacial Group in Phoenix, AZ, devoting her clinical work to diagnosing and managing conditions affecting the jaw, facial muscles, and related pain pathways. Her ABOP board certification, active since 2020 under Certification Number ABOP1540, confirms she has satisfied the profession's most rigorous standards for orofacial pain expertise. Beyond the Office

Assistant professor at Arizona School of Dentistry and Oral Health (ASDOH), teaching special needs dentistry

Lectures internationally on bleeding disorders and special care dentistry

Serves on Maricopa County Ryan White Part A Quality Committee

North American delegate to dental committee of World Federation of Hemophilia

Works with Arizona Hemophilia Association

Chairperson of Council of Dentistry for People with Disabilities (Special Care Dentistry Association)

Co-authored dental guides for treating people with autism

Co-authored chapter on quality management for National Network for Oral Health Access

Critical summary writer for ADA Evidence-Based Dentistry website

Previously directed pediatric mobile dentistry unit for Columbia University

Patients know her as Dr. Rebecca

Has mission work focused on helping underserved populations

Previously maintained a mobile dental practice caring for homebound, hospitalized, and nursing home patients in New Jersey
